Significance of Ganesh Chaturthi: Celebrated with enthusiasm, Ganesh Chaturthi holds a vital place in Hindu traditions, occurring annually on the Chaturthi of Shukla Paksha in the month of Bhadrapada. Homes and public spaces alike welcome Ganesha, with festivities lasting for 11 days. If you plan to place a Ganesha idol in your home or a pandal, adhering to specific guidelines is crucial. These rules, rooted in scripture and tradition, enhance the worship experience and ensure smooth proceedings. Here’s what to consider when selecting a Ganesha idol.

Key Considerations for Ganesha Idol Selection:


Idol Material and Orientation:


Idols crafted from clay (Shadu Mati) are deemed the most auspicious. Idols made from metal or plaster of Paris (POP) are not recommended according to traditional texts. Ideally, Ganesha should face east or north, while worshippers should position themselves facing west or south.


Idol Size and Placement:


For home installations, idols up to 1.5 feet are preferable. Avoid bringing in excessively large idols. Select a clean, sacred, and well-ventilated area for placement. It is advised against placing the idol near kitchens or bathrooms. The idol should not be placed directly on the ground; instead, use a stool or platter covered with red or yellow fabric.


Direction of Ganesha's Trunk:


An idol with its trunk oriented to the right (Siddhivinayak form) is considered highly auspicious and requires strict adherence to worship protocols. Conversely, a left-trunked idol is favorable for family harmony and simpler worship practices.


Moshak Accompaniment:


If Ganesha is depicted seated (dressed in red, with one hand in a blessing gesture), it symbolizes an increase in wealth, joy, and wisdom. A standing Ganesha is auspicious for business ventures and new beginnings. Remember to include modak and moshak when acquiring the idol.



Bringing the Idol Home:


When transporting the idol, wrap it in red or yellow cloth. Ensure the idol is held above your head and never placed underfoot. As you bring it home, chant 'Ganpati Bappa Morya' to invoke blessings.
